Truck Plunges into Eleme River, Others Blame Faulty Bridge

Rivers State

A truck conveying twelve feet container on Friday skidded off a bridge and fell into Aleto river, along the East-West Road, in Eleme Local Government Area of Rivers State. The incident which occurred at about 3pm, did not record any casualty as the driver of the truck came out unhurt, according to eyewitness account. A […]

NUJ Rivers State Council Concludes Revalidation Exercise

NUJ

The Nigeria Union of Journalists (NUJ) Rivers State Council has successfully concluded a one-week revalidation exercise for its members. Over 200 practicing journalists participated in the exercise, which aimed to eliminate quackery and compile a membership compendium. The exercise, initially scheduled from July 7 to 11, 2025, was extended by two days (July 14 and […]

100 Households in Kaani Community to Benefit from Solar Power Project Backed by UNDP-GEF

One hundred households in the Kaani community, Khana Local Government Area of Rivers State, are set to receive sustainable electricity through a solar energy project initiated by the Lekeh Development Foundation with support from the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) Global Environment Facility (GEF) Small Grants Programme. The project, titled “Accelerating Clean Energy Transition for […]

LG Election: Rivers PDP Debunks Claim of Sale of Forms

PDP

The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, Rivers State, has in strong terms debunked the claims that the party has commenced the sale of forms for chairmanship and councillorship elections across the 23 local government areas of the state. The party described the publication making the rounds on social media as baseless and untrue. In a statement […]
